i dont know the exact amount, but i do know that you inhale chemicles like rat poison, and formeldihyte a chemicle you embalm bodys in about 4,000-here are a few: Nicotine: a deadly poison Arsenic: used in rat poison Methane: a component of rocket fuel Ammonia: found in floor cleaner Cadmium: used in batteries Carbon Monoxide: part of car exhaust Formaldehyde: used to preserve body tissue Butane: lighter fluid Hydrogen Cyanide: the poison used in gas chambers Every time you inhale smoke from a cigarette, small amounts of these chemicals get into your blood through your lungs. They travel to all the parts of your body and cause harm. http://www.youngwomenshealth.org/smokeinfo.html (its not just about women...the smoking part is for both genders....bottom line DONT SMOKE!!!!!
